										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>SAN FRANCISCO &#8211; It&#8217;s finally time for some luck!  New Year celebrations will look different this year, but the traditions will remain the same.  A San Francisco restaurant wants customers to usher in the Year of the Ox with a table filled with classic, happy foods for a successful fresh start. </p>
<p>The family-run Hong Kong Lounge is located in SF&#8217;s Outer Richmond District and serves as the staple for classic dim sum in the Bay Area.  During this lunar new year, the restaurant offers a variety of take-away specialties, including a giant pot of festive foods known as a poon choi.  This traditional dish is overflowing with special meat, seafood and vegetables that symbolize wealth and fortune.</p>
<p>Sweet treats also play an important role in the New Year&#8217;s dishes.  The Hong Kong Lounge caters to customers Nian Gao (Year Cake) and Fa Gao (Prosperity Cake).  Nian Gao is a circular, sticky rice cake most popularly consumed during the Lunar New Year to promote togetherness and happiness for a better year.  Fa Gao is a steamed, yellow cake that is successful when consumed.</p>
<p>As the manager of her family&#8217;s restaurant, Tiffany Zhou hopes that New Year&#8217;s dinner at the Hong Kong Lounge will bring much-needed joy to families.</p>
<p>&#8220;I want you to be happy,&#8221; said Zhou.  &#8220;And just remember, you know, sometimes you have to slow down and just enjoy the moment.&#8221; </p>
